Transaction 66006b7b0581c1e44baf85a2f4347c9dbad5ae527ea71a72f02b5e12d4743df9
1 Input
1 Output
-
66006b7b0581c1e44baf85a2f4347c9dbad5ae527ea71a72f02b5e12d4743df9:0
- value
- 953344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fbbf402da958d3230cac4651b065f2aae5cd37a OP_EQUAL
- address
- 38xcTuw6uMREhHHMuRSxtKfD41HnEKA5mu